Family Office vs REPE
For those with experience/insight, what are your thoughts on working for a well capitalized (+$2bn net worth) and active (~5 deals purchased TTM) family office (CRE focus) with a lean headcount vs going into REPE?
Looking for insights on comp, experience/education, Industry exposure, wlb, foundation for longterm career building, etc.
Following
Family office money tends to be more long-term plays and patient with no need for a near term capital event. From my perspective in multifamily, this is the type of buyer that is going to be most active between now and 2028. If you are going to an REPE shop especially one without a fund and needs to source equity per deal expect a whole lot of nothing for the next 2 years.
This is the way. REPE shops can't afford to hold the stash until the cap rates drop, HNWs can.
Family office >>>
Any other cycle, REPE>FO, but right now, FO all the way. Less upside but you're active (which gives you long term upside) over the current REPE guy who has illusory upside (it aint coming) and can't be active. Stability / staying power is name of game in this market, and FO has that in spades. How does working in a FO stack up against other RE paths long-term for building personal wealth? Brokerage, institutional investment, lending, etc?
All of them depend on participation.
If you’re only getting salary + bonus, you aren’t building wealth.
